Mru vim github for mac

This will automatically install vim with the features of the huge vim install brew install vim withoverridesystemvi the output of this command will show you where brew installed vim. But those things are only great after youve pushed your code to github. If you already installed vim andor ruby with sudo aptget install vim or sudo aptget install ruby or with brew install vim e. If you want to open the vimrc file you can do it by typing. Github desktop focus on what matters instead of fighting with git.

To alex kras whose web page how to run meld on mac os x yosemite without homebrew, macports, or think served as my reference for tracking meld for osx usage and issues when i had absolutely no time to maintain this. Otherwise if you want to use the system clipboard at all time you can manually set the clipboard to be unnamed as others recommended. Added the mru file list to the file menu in gui vim. Aug 30, 2018 most recently used mru vim plugin the most recently used mru plugin provides an easy access to a list of recently openededited files in vim. Most recently used mru vim plugin the most recently used mru plugin provides an easy access to a list of recently openededited files in vim. This includes the installation of the cli mvim and the mac application which both point to the same thing. Vim awesome is a directory of vim plugins sourced from github, vim. Installing youcompleteme plugin for vim on mac osx yosemite. I use sourcetree to view history and compare commits to each other or to the current state of the working copy, and the graphical view is indispensable for this. Written in pure vimscript for macvim, gvim and vim 7. Fixed the problem with one vim session overwritting the mru list from another vim session. Made with vim and vigor by david hu, sophie alpert, and emily eisenberg. On yosemite, install vim using brew and the overridesystemvi option.

Github desktop simple collaboration from your desktop. Ive been using macvim and the builtin vim but copying to the clipboard is clunky. There is also a version for mac osx that works in a terminal window and a gui version for x11 with gtk produced by. Vim awesome is a directory of vim plugins sourced from github, and user submissions. After installing the patched font and setting the vim font just open or look at any of the supported plugins you have installed nerdtree, airline, powerline, unite, lightline.

May 12, 2020 github desktop has no graphical view of commits, which makes it a nonstarter for me. Installing youcompleteme plugin for vim on mac osx. Vim is a highly configurable text editor built to make creating and changing any kind of text very efficient. Download for macos download for windows 64bit download for macos or windows msi download for windows. What is the difference between macvim and regular vim. This is a bad idea and it is not the clean way to do it. It is included as vi with most unix systems and with apple os x. Well, os x expects that nothing will ever change in usrbin unbeknownst to it, so any time you overwrite stuff in there you risk breaking some intricate interdependency. Vim awesome is a directory of vim plugins sourced from github, and user. Brew even takes care of installing vim with the preferable options. In the first chapter im describing how to build it from source for ubuntu. This may be a good vimscript exercise for you, but determining the current platform is done in like 7 lines of a very straightforward vimscript conditional so i dont see any benefit for the end user in using a thirdparty plugin for such a trivial task. Get rid of the meld wrapper shell script this should get rid of all the wrappers needed to run meld from the terminal. Hi, i have updated the mru plugin and added the following features.

By downloading, you agree to the open source applications terms. If you are using an earlier version of vim, then you should use an older version of the mru plugin. Homebrew brew install macvim release settings vundle. Subscribe to the vim mac maillist to be informed about bugs and updates. Contribute to barretleeautoconfig macvimrc development by creating an account on github. Meld helps you compare files, directories, and version controlled projects.

Whether youre new to git or a seasoned user, github desktop simplifies your development workflow. It provides two and threeway comparison of both files and directories, and has support for many popular version control systems such as git, mercurial and others. While in vim before you paste try doing this commandset paste. I assume you are talking about macvim and not vanilla vim vim running on terminal.

If i understand things correctly, you want to install over your existing vim, for better or worse. Pull requests, merge button, fork queue, issues, pages, wiki. To fully learn git, youll need to set up both git and github on your mac. Meld is a visual diff and merge tool targeted at developers. Macvim is a port of the text editor vim to mac os x that is meant to look better and integrate more seamlessly with the mac than the older carbon port of vim macvim supports multiple windows with tabbed editing and a host of other features such as. This article is part of the ongoing vi vim tips and tricks series. This also explains about 7 powerful feature of the most recently used plugin. Compiling vim for linuxmac with ruby and python support. Contribute to hotoovimrc development by creating an account on github. Anything you are used to do in vim will work exactly the same way in macvim. Other shortcuts include cmdt for new tab, cmdw to close window, cmdn to open a new window.

Recent binaries for mac osx can be found on this sourceforge project. Apr 12, 2020 macvim is a port of the text editor vim to mac os x that is meant to look better and integrate more seamlessly with the mac than the older carbon port of vim. Release notes for github desktop for mac github desktop. This plugin will work on all the platforms where vim is supported. Feb 28, 2017 most recently used mru vim plugin the most recently used mru plugin provides an easy access to a list of recently openededited files in vim. Compiling vim for linux mac with ruby and python support. Macvim supports multiple windows with tabbed editing and a host of other features such as. I have a lot of installed vim plugins on my local, but i only use some of it. Both are long youve been programming, and what tools youve installed, you may already have git on your computer. Macvim is more integrated in the whole os than vim in the terminal or even gvim in linux, it follows a lot of mac os xs conventions.

This plugin automatically stores the file names as you openedit them in vim. Lokaltogs easymotion this provides a much simplier way to use some motions in vim. Instead of using a vim global variable to store the mru list, used a separate file to store the mru list. The software is provided as is, without warranty of any kind. Either way touch bar support wont work when you use vim in terminal. Github desktop allows developers to synchronize branches, clone repositories, and more. Scrooloose nerdtree i seldom use this but this provides a sidebar directory. The github repository for the mru plugin is available at. This way you can use the regular yanketc commands using the vim internal clipboard. Plugin usage data is extracted from dotfiles repos on github.

1215 916 87 1322 1275 1165 209 593 654 1613 979 1146 997 1434 364 1058 580 38 657 500 884 794 1480 454 1572 1586 519 376 1093 1427 940 148 1209 336 970 896 305 1177 1388 574 890 1102 1303 1146 1259 717 38